Re: [Puppet Users] Using fact to determine node environment

2012-05-02 Thread Nigel Kersten
On Wed, May 2, 2012 at 8:53 AM, R.I.Pienaar wrote: > > > > > I think you're thinking of the ENC setting the environment, not a > > > > fact called 'environment' RI? > > > > > > nope. > > > > > > > > > Anyone got a bug # for this? > > > > pretty sure there was one but couldnt find it so I just kno

Re: [Puppet Users] Using fact to determine node environment

2012-05-02 Thread R.I.Pienaar
- Original Message - > From: "R.I.Pienaar" > To: puppet-users@googlegroups.com > Sent: Wednesday, May 2, 2012 4:46:24 PM > Subject: Re: [Puppet Users] Using fact to determine node environment > > > > - Original Message - > > Fro

Re: [Puppet Users] Using fact to determine node environment

2012-05-02 Thread R.I.Pienaar
- Original Message - > From: "Nigel Kersten" > To: puppet-users@googlegroups.com > Sent: Wednesday, May 2, 2012 4:38:38 PM > Subject: Re: [Puppet Users] Using fact to determine node environment > > > > > On Wed, May 2, 2012 at 8:37 AM,

Re: [Puppet Users] Using fact to determine node environment

2012-05-02 Thread Nigel Kersten
On Wed, May 2, 2012 at 8:37 AM, R.I.Pienaar wrote: > > > > Unless something broke it recently, I ran for years with a fact > > > that > > > returned ":environment" and didn't set it in puppet.conf at all. > > > > yes, it broke. You'll get a mix of files from one environment and > > classes > > fr

Re: [Puppet Users] Using fact to determine node environment

2012-05-02 Thread R.I.Pienaar
- Original Message - > From: "Nigel Kersten" > To: puppet-users@googlegroups.com > Sent: Wednesday, May 2, 2012 4:24:06 PM > Subject: Re: [Puppet Users] Using fact to determine node environment > > > > > On Wed, May 2, 2012 at 8:18 AM,

Re: [Puppet Users] Using fact to determine node environment

2012-05-02 Thread Nigel Kersten
On Wed, May 2, 2012 at 8:18 AM, R.I.Pienaar wrote: > > > - Original Message - > > From: "Nigel Kersten" > > To: puppet-users@googlegroups.com > > Sent: Wednesday, May 2, 2012 4:10:16 PM > > Subject: Re: [Puppet Users] Using fact to determine

Re: [Puppet Users] Using fact to determine node environment

2012-05-02 Thread R.I.Pienaar
- Original Message - > From: "Nigel Kersten" > To: puppet-users@googlegroups.com > Sent: Wednesday, May 2, 2012 4:10:16 PM > Subject: Re: [Puppet Users] Using fact to determine node environment > > > > > On Wed, May 2, 2012 at 4:19 AM,

Re: [Puppet Users] Using fact to determine node environment

2012-05-02 Thread John Kennedy
On Wed, May 2, 2012 at 11:10 AM, Nigel Kersten wrote: > > > On Wed, May 2, 2012 at 4:19 AM, R.I.Pienaar wrote: > >> >> >> - Original Message - >> > From: "John Kennedy" >> > To: puppet-users@googlegroups.com >> > Sent: Wednesday, May 2, 2012 11:59:49 AM >> > Subject: [Puppet Users] Usin

Re: [Puppet Users] Using fact to determine node environment

2012-05-02 Thread Nigel Kersten
On Wed, May 2, 2012 at 4:19 AM, R.I.Pienaar wrote: > > > - Original Message - > > From: "John Kennedy" > > To: puppet-users@googlegroups.com > > Sent: Wednesday, May 2, 2012 11:59:49 AM > > Subject: [Puppet Users] Using fact to determine node environment > > > > We have a custom fact tha

Re: [Puppet Users] Using fact to determine node environment

2012-05-02 Thread Dan Carley
On 2 May 2012 12:19, R.I.Pienaar wrote: > > your only option at present is to write out puppet.conf using a template > with your fact We use this approach. The very first run gets called with "--environment foo" and it sticks. "--environment" can then be called again if it needs to move to anoth

Re: [Puppet Users] Using fact to determine node environment

2012-05-02 Thread R.I.Pienaar
- Original Message - > From: "John Kennedy" > To: puppet-users@googlegroups.com > Sent: Wednesday, May 2, 2012 11:59:49 AM > Subject: [Puppet Users] Using fact to determine node environment > > We have a custom fact that we wrote to determine which (business) > environment a specific se